Microlaryngeal Surgery in India – What Is This Advanced Voice Surgery?

Microlaryngeal surgery in India involves the use of an operating microscope and ultra-fine surgical instruments to treat lesions on the vocal cords through the mouth, without any external incision. The surgeon operates with extreme precision, ensuring minimal trauma to surrounding healthy tissue.

This technique is especially valuable because the vocal cords are highly sensitive structures responsible for speech, breathing, and airway protection.

Vocal Cord Nodules
Vocal cord nodules are small, symmetrical growths that develop due to chronic voice strain, making them common among teachers, singers, public speakers, and call-center professionals. These nodules interfere with the vibration of the vocal cords, leading to hoarseness and voice fatigue. Microlaryngeal surgery precisely removes the nodules while maintaining the integrity of the vocal cords, allowing the voice to return to its natural clarity.

Vocal Cord Polyps
Polyps are usually unilateral (one-sided) lesions caused by acute voice abuse, smoking, or irritation. They often result in persistent hoarseness or voice breaks. Microlaryngeal Surgery in India enables surgeons to delicately excise polyps without damaging surrounding tissue, significantly improving voice quality and preventing recurrence.

Vocal Cord Cysts
Vocal cord cysts are fluid-filled or solid lesions located beneath the surface of the vocal cords. They can severely disrupt vocal cord vibration and often do not respond to voice therapy alone. Microlaryngeal surgery allows complete and careful removal of the cyst wall, restoring smooth vocal cord movement and optimal voice production.

Reinke’s Edema
Reinke’s edema involves swelling of the superficial layer of the vocal cords, often associated with long-term smoking, acid reflux, or voice misuse. Patients typically experience a deep, rough, or husky voice. Through Microlaryngeal Surgery in India, excess fluid and swollen tissue are removed, helping restore a clearer, stronger voice while preventing further vocal damage.

Chronic Hoarseness
Chronic hoarseness lasting longer than a few weeks may indicate underlying structural abnormalities or lesions of the vocal cords. Microlaryngeal surgery helps identify and treat the root cause, ensuring accurate diagnosis and targeted treatment that improves long-term vocal health.

Vocal Cord Granulomas
Granulomas are inflammatory growths often caused by acid reflux, prolonged intubation, or vocal trauma. These lesions can cause pain, throat discomfort, and voice changes. Microlaryngeal Surgery in India is used when conservative treatments fail, allowing precise removal while addressing contributing factors such as reflux to prevent recurrence.

Early-Stage Vocal Cord Cancer
In cases of early-stage vocal cord cancer, microlaryngeal surgery offers a minimally invasive treatment option with excellent outcomes. Using microsurgical or laser techniques, surgeons can remove cancerous tissue while preserving voice quality and avoiding more extensive procedures. Voice Disorders Caused by Reflux or Trauma
Chronic acid reflux (laryngopharyngeal reflux) and physical trauma can damage vocal cord tissues, leading to inflammation, scarring, or lesions. Microlaryngeal Surgery in India addresses these structural changes directly, restoring normal vocal cord anatomy and improving voice strength and endurance.

Microlaryngeal Surgery in India – How the Procedure Is Performed

Microlaryngeal surgery in India is performed under general anesthesia in a fully equipped operating theater.

The procedure includes:

  • Insertion of a laryngoscope through the mouth
  • Magnified visualization of vocal cords using an operating microscope
  • Precise removal or correction of the lesion
  • Preservation of normal vocal cord tissue

The surgery typically takes 30–60 minutes, with no external cuts or scars.

Microlaryngeal Surgery in India – Recovery and Voice Rehabilitation

Microlaryngeal surgery in India is followed by a structured recovery plan to protect the healing vocal cords.

Post-surgery care includes:

  • Short period of voice rest
  • Gradual voice use under guidance
  • Voice therapy with speech-language pathologists
  • Treatment of contributing factors like acid reflux

Most patients notice significant voice improvement within weeks.
